  • "They didn't have the funds to teach their workers how to follow simple guidelines?"

    It's not important whether they had the funds or not. It's know that at the time of the accident the operators were a skeleton crew; most of which had not read the manual and had come from unrelated industries.

    "How did they build those four fucking HUGE reactors then?"

    You mean those extremely poorly designed reactors(POSITIVE void coefficient for fucks sake!) with a distinct lack of emergency features?

  • "something like this could have happened anywhere."

    The darned thing had a POSITIVE void coefficient! The control rods had tips made of GRAPHITE.

    They carried out an experiment with a skeleton crew at night with inexperienced operators. Didn't abort at the first sign of trouble. Didn't know the reactor was poisoned with xenon at low power. Withdrew control rods ment to be permanently in the reactor manually(no design should allow this!).
